Mobile patrol services

With business operations still greatly impacted by the recent pandemic, many premises, sites and offices continue to stay empty and therefore are more susceptible to a variety of issues including water leaks, criminal damage and other serious situations.

By investing in a mobile patrol team, business owners can maintain strict standards required by insurance companies and stay safe in the knowledge that their livelihood is protected.
